Clean Energy Group’s Resilient Power Project is hosting a webianr on Wednesday, August 31 at 2 pm to share a a clean energy project of Glad Tidings International church, a critical facility for the community of South Hayward in the Bay Area of California. To make sure they can support their congregation and community during a power outage, as well as to accelerate South Hayward’s transition to clean energy, Glad Tidings applied to Clean Energy Group’s Technical Assistance Fund  to assess the feasibility of creating a clean energy hub.
This Clean Energy Group webinar will provide an overview of how the congregation decided to pursue this innovative project, and we will get an overview of the resulting project from Gemini Energy Solutions. Gemini will also discuss their effort to bring Black-owned businesses into the scope of the project.
Speakers from OpConnect will discuss how they integrated a small fleet of electric vehicles into the solar+storage resilience component of the clean energy hub.
